Medical Imaging Interaction Toolkit  2018.4.99-389bf124
Medical Imaging Interaction Toolkit
QmitkPickingToolGUI Class Reference

GUI for mitk::LiveWireTool. More...

#include <QmitkPickingToolGUI.h>

Inheritance diagram for QmitkPickingToolGUI:
Collaboration diagram for QmitkPickingToolGUI:

Public Member Functions

 mitkClassMacro (QmitkPickingToolGUI, QmitkToolGUI)
 
Pointer Clone () const
 
- Public Member Functions inherited from QmitkToolGUI
 mitkClassMacroItkParent (QmitkToolGUI, itk::Object)
 
void SetTool (mitk::Tool *tool)
 
void Register () const override
 
void UnRegister () const ITK_NOEXCEPT ITK_OVERRIDE
 
void SetReferenceCount (int) override
 
 ~QmitkToolGUI () override
 

Static Public Member Functions

static Pointer New ()
 

Protected Slots

void OnNewToolAssociated (mitk::Tool *)
 
void OnConfirmSegmentation ()
 

Protected Member Functions

 QmitkPickingToolGUI ()
 
 ~QmitkPickingToolGUI () override
 
- Protected Member Functions inherited from QmitkToolGUI
virtual void BusyStateChanged (bool)
 

Protected Attributes

Ui::QmitkPickingToolGUIControls m_Controls
 
mitk::PickingTool::Pointer m_PickingTool
 
- Protected Attributes inherited from QmitkToolGUI
mitk::Tool::Pointer m_Tool
 

Additional Inherited Members

- Signals inherited from QmitkToolGUI
void NewToolAssociated (mitk::Tool *)
 

Detailed Description

GUI for mitk::LiveWireTool.

See also
mitk::PickingTool

Definition at line 36 of file QmitkPickingToolGUI.h.

Constructor & Destructor Documentation

◆ QmitkPickingToolGUI()

QmitkPickingToolGUI::QmitkPickingToolGUI ( )
protected

Definition at line 27 of file QmitkPickingToolGUI.cpp.

◆ ~QmitkPickingToolGUI()

QmitkPickingToolGUI::~QmitkPickingToolGUI ( )
overrideprotected

Definition at line 36 of file QmitkPickingToolGUI.cpp.

Member Function Documentation

◆ Clone()

Pointer QmitkPickingToolGUI::Clone ( ) const

◆ mitkClassMacro()

QmitkPickingToolGUI::mitkClassMacro ( QmitkPickingToolGUI  ,
QmitkToolGUI   
)

◆ New()

static Pointer QmitkPickingToolGUI::New ( )
static

◆ OnConfirmSegmentation

void QmitkPickingToolGUI::OnConfirmSegmentation ( )
protectedslot

Definition at line 45 of file QmitkPickingToolGUI.cpp.

References m_PickingTool.

◆ OnNewToolAssociated

void QmitkPickingToolGUI::OnNewToolAssociated ( mitk::Tool tool)
protectedslot

Definition at line 40 of file QmitkPickingToolGUI.cpp.

References m_PickingTool.

Member Data Documentation

◆ m_Controls

Ui::QmitkPickingToolGUIControls QmitkPickingToolGUI::m_Controls
protected

Definition at line 55 of file QmitkPickingToolGUI.h.

◆ m_PickingTool

mitk::PickingTool::Pointer QmitkPickingToolGUI::m_PickingTool
protected

Definition at line 57 of file QmitkPickingToolGUI.h.

Referenced by OnConfirmSegmentation(), and OnNewToolAssociated().


The documentation for this class was generated from the following files: